✨Miso Pecan Buns✨

To celebrate the launch of the new Everything Miso Sauce, the kind team at have sent me some to try.

I’ve used it to make these browned butter miso pecan buns, with an Everything Miso Sauce glaze.

📖 Here’s the recipe:
Bread:
260g strong bread flour
13g caster sugar
1/2 tsp salt
4g dried yeast
125g whole milk
60g egg
60g butter
-
(Optional) Caramel:
50g sugar
-
Filling:
120g butter, browned and cooled
30g Everything Miso Sauce
50g light brown sugar
125g toasted pecans (reserve some for topping)
-
Glaze:
30g brown sugar
10g Everything Miso Sauce
30g water
-
Line 9 inch pan
1. Make dry caramel in a pan and pour onto a sheet of grease proof paper. Once cooled, break up into little shards & place at the bottom of your pan.
2. Make the dough, check for gluten development & proof.
3. Filling: Mix the cooled brown butter, miso sauce & brown sugar together.
4. Roll the dough out roughly 30x40cm.
5. Spread the filling, sprinkle with the toasted pecans.
6. Roll the dough and cut into 6 rolls.
7. Place into prepared tin and proof.
8. Bake at 190c fan for 24-30 mins.
9. Make the glaze: heat all ingredients in saucepan until bubbling, then set aside.
10. Brush the baked buns with the glaze & scatter over the reserved pecans.

Cooked too much rice again? We’ve got just the thing for you👇

Turn it into this crispy rice and chicken salad with a zingy Miso dressing we’d put on just about anything! This is a great one to batch make for lunch, just add the Miso dressing when you’re ready to serve to keep everything nice and crunchy

Ingredients

Salad Dressing:
3 tbsp soy sauce
1 tsp sesame oil
10g pickled ginger juice
1 tbsp honey
1 tsp sesame oil
10g sesame seeds, toasted
20g Miso Tasty White Miso Paste

Crispy Rice:
250g pre-cooked rice/ day-old rice
2 tbsp soy sauce

Salad Ingredients:
2 breaded chicken breasts
150g edamame beans
1/2 cucumber
1 spring onion
40g pickled ginger
1 avocado
sprinkle of sesame seeds, toasted

Method
1. Preheat the oven to 220°C. Toss the rice with the soy sauce, then spread it out evenly on a baking tray. Bake for 15 minutes, stirring halfway through. For extra crispy rice, use pre-cooked or day-old rice and ensure it’s as dry as possible.
2. Meanwhile, prepare the dressing by combining all the ingredients in a bowl and whisking until smooth and fully combined.Once the rice is done, remove it from the oven and lower the temperature to 180°C. Add the chicken to the oven and cook for 15 minutes, or until fully cooked through.
3. While the chicken cooks, prepare the salad ingredients. Chop the cucumber and avocado and finely slice the spring onions.
4. Add those ingredients to a large bowl along with the pickled ginger, edamame beans, cooked chicken, and crispy rice.
5. Pour over the dressing and toss everything together until well combined.
6. Finish by sprinkling over toasted sesame seeds, then serve and enjoy!
Have you checked the weather app/gone outside today?? It is HOT 🥵

We’re keeping cool with this refreshing Miso iced coffee. It’s sweet, creamy and ever so slightly umami – the best way to start the sunny weekend ahead ☀️

Ingredients:
1 double espresso
4g demerara sugar
9g Miso Tasty White Miso Paste
25g condensed milk
100ml milk of your choice
handful of ice

Method:
1. Brew a double espresso. While still hot, add the sugar, condensed milk and white miso. Blend or whisk until completely smooth and the miso paste has fully dissolved.
2. Fill a glass with ice, then pour over the miso coffee mixture.
3. Top with your milk of choice, give it a gentle stir and enjoy!
There is a hidden ingredient inside these No Bake Miso Snickers Bars that you probably wouldn't expect to see.. It's WHITE MISO PASTE by. Its umami flavour and ability to enhance other ingredients makes this the perfect addition to this recipe and many other sweets. Here is how to make these delicious No Bake Miso Snickers Bars.

BASE
- 200-250g (10-14) pitted medjool dates
- 250g (1½ cups) raw almonds

CARAMEL
- 20g (1 tbsp) Miso Tasty White Miso Paste (add more slowly if you prefer a stronger flavour).
- 400g (around 20) medjool dates
- 140g (½ cup) peanut butter
- 80g (¼ cup) rice malt syrup or maple syrup
- Pinch of salt

PEANUTS:
- 150g (1 cup) natural/roasted peanuts

TOP:
- 200g chocolate
- 10g (2 tsp) coconut oil

Method:
- Grease and line a 20cm x 20cm baking tray.
- Pit all of the dates. Place 400g of dates for the caramel into a deep bowl, cover with boiling water and let it sit for 15 minutes or until the dates are soft.
- Add the almonds into a food processor, along with 10 dates and continue to add more if the mixture is too dry. Blend until the mixture starts to combine together.
- Press the mixture evenly into the lined baking tray.
- Once the dates for the caramel are soft, drain add them to the food processor.
- Add the other caramel ingredients, including the White Miso Paste and blend in a food processor until smooth.
- Adjust the taste of the caramel with more white miso paste and flaky salt.
- Spread the caramel evenly onto the base mixture.
- Add the peanuts to the top of the caramel. Lightly push them in.
- Melt the chocolate and coconut oil. Mix until smooth.
- Pour the chocolate evenly onto the peanut layer and place in the fridge for an hour until set.
- Remove from the tray and cut into bars.
- Freeze for 2-3 months or 1 week in a sealed container in the fridge. Grab and enjoy.

MISO SALMON & SOBA NOODLE SALAD 🐟

Miso Dressing:
2 x tbsp light soy
2 x tbsp balsamic vinegar
2 x tbsp white wine vinegar
1 x tbsp White Miso Paste
1 x tbsp brown sugar
2-3 cloves Garlic
1 x tbsp sesame oil
1 tsp each Black & White Sesame Seeds

Salad:
2 x Fillets Wild Caught NZ Salmon
1 x Bunch Broccolini, Chopped
1 x Handful Snowpeas, Chopped
1 x Bunch Soba Noodles
1 x tbsp Bone Broth (stock will do)
1 x Lime
1/2 Bunch Coriander, Chopped
2 x Cloves Garlic

- Combine all dressing ingredients in a airtight jar, shake to combine, set aside
- Chop garlic snow peas, broccolini & fry off until fragrant
- Add bone broth or stock, juice of 1/2 lime
- Boil Soba Noodles for 2 minutes, strain and rinse with cold water
- Sear Salmon in hot pan for approx 1.5 mins per side
- Combine soba, greens, miso dressing & season with lime juice, chopped coriander
- Serve with salmon on the side or flaked throughout

Miso Garlic Butter Focaccia using
White Miso Paste

-Ingredients-

Miso Garlic Butter Topping

70g butter, unsalted, softened
1 tbsp Miso Tasty White Miso Paste
2-3 garlic cloves, finely grated
1 tbsp honey
1-2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
Sea salt, flakes
Optional: spring onion, any herbs
Dough

300g bread flour (or plain/all-purpose)
3.5g instant yeast
4.5g salt
280ml warm water, 40-45°C
-Method-

Put the flour, yeast and salt into a bowl and mix.
Make a well in the centre, pour in the warm water and mix until no dry flour remains
No need to knead, you can relax.
Cover and place in a warm spot for about 1-2 hours until doubled - if you got the time.
Over medium low heat, add softened butter to a pot and let it melt.
Add garlic and cook until fragrant
Strain the butter and garlic and add Miso Tasty White Miso Paste into the butter.
You can save the garlic for another dish or eat it on its own (i wont judge)
Set aside while you wait for the focaccia.
If it solidifies you can microwave it, only need’s 10-20 seconds - so its back to liquid form.
Line a baking pan with baking paper.
Drizzle some olive oil.
Pour the risen dough into the pan.
Gentle push the dough into all corners.
Cover and leave it to rise again for 45 minutes.
Preheat the oven to 220°C.
Drizzle more olive oil on the dough.
Oil your fingertips and lightly dimple the dough.
Add flakey sea salt and any herbs of your choice.
Bake for 28 minutes until golden brown, rotate at 15 minutes for even coverage.
Place on a wire rack and immediately baste with miso garlic butter.
and enjoy!
